Another Patriot release I acquired at the same time as the AOA 767 (and before the current conflict) is the IIAF KC 747 5-8107. This version comes with quite a set of accessories. As well as the usual postcard and stand there's a collector's card, velcro badge, 2 versions of the refueling boom and gear up door components. The landing gear sticks on only with sticky plastic and not magnets, which isn't ideal but I'm happy to display the model gears up anyway. Sadly this 1971 build ex-TWA frame (as N93118), originally part of Eastern's cancelled order and sold to the Imperial Iranian Air Force in 1975, was destroyed by US-Israeli airstrikes at Tehran on March 7 during their illegal war with Iran.
